This System Reference document serves as a comprehensive guide for the DIGITAL Server 7100 Series, detailing its operation, upgrading, configuration, and troubleshooting. It introduces the server as a high-performance, scalable network and enterprise solution, highlighting its modular processor and storage technology, ECC memory, dual-channel storage backplane, and redundant power supplies.
The document provides extensive information on essential server software and utilities, including ServerWORKS Quick Launch for OS installation, the System Configuration Utility (SCU) for hardware configuration and resource management, RAID Configuration Utility, BIOS Upgrade Utility, SCSISelect Utility, and diagnostic tools. It offers step-by-step procedures for installing and replacing internal components such as processor modules, additional memory (DIMMs), and various disk and tape drives, including hot-swap Storage Building Blocks (SBBs). Guidelines for installing and configuring ISA, EISA, and PCI expansion boards, as well as connecting SCSI and RAID adapters, are also included.
Furthermore, the guide outlines server management functions, security features like physical locks and supervisor passwords, and comprehensive troubleshooting steps for a wide array of problems related to the server, disk drives, SBBs, tape drives, monitors, CD-ROMs, diskette drives, RAID systems, and SCSI bus repeater modules. Appendices provide detailed technical specifications, device mapping information, and a complete list of SCU features, alongside recommendations for server care and relocation.
